###########################################################################
# #
# This is the configuration file for CUPS-PDF. Values that are not set in #
# here will use the defaults. Changes take effect immediately without the #
# need for restarting any services. #
# #
# Take care not to add whitespaces at the end of a line! #
# #
# Options are marked where they can be set (setting via PPD requires the #
# PPD file that comes with CUPS-PDF to be used!). #
# Options passed via lpoptions that are not named for lpoptions here are #
# ignored. #
# Options precedence is as follows: #
# 1st: lpoptions #
# 2nd: PPD settings #
# 3rd: config file (this file) #
# 4th: default values #
###########################################################################
###########################################################################
# #
# Path Settings #
# #
###########################################################################
### Key: Out (config)
## CUPS-PDF output directory
## special qualifiers:
## ${HOME} will be expanded to the user's home directory
## ${USER} will be expanded to the user name
## in case it is an NFS export make sure it is exported without
## root_squash!
### Default: /var/spool/cups-pdf/${USER}
#Out /var/spool/cups-pdf/${USER}
### Key: AnonDirName (config)
## ABSOLUTE path for anonymously created PDF files
## if anonymous access is disabled this setting has no effect
### Default: /var/spool/cups-pdf/ANONYMOUS
#AnonDirName /var/spool/cups-pdf/ANONYMOUS
### Key: Spool (config)
## CUPS-PDF spool directory - make sure there is no user 'SPOOL' on your
## system or change the path
### Default: /var/spool/cups-pdf/SPOOL
#Spool /var/spool/cups-pdf/SPOOL
###########################################################################
# #
# Filename Settings #
# #
###########################################################################
### Key: Truncate (config, ppd, lpoptions)
## truncate long filenames to a maximum of <Truncate> characters
## this does not consider the full path to the output but only the filename
## without the .pdf-extension or a job-id prefix (see 'Label')
## the minimal value is 8
### Default: 64
#Truncate 64
### Key: Cut (config, lpoptions)
## removing file name extensions before appending .pdf to output
## extensions will only be removed if _both_ the following criteria are met:
## - the extension (w/o the dot) is not longer than <Cut> characters
## - the remaining filename has a minimal length of 1 character
## set Cut to -1 in order to disable cutting
## recommended values: pure UNIX environment : -1
## mixed environments : 3
### Default: 3
#Cut 3
### Key: Label (config, ppd, lpoptions)
## label all jobs with a unique job-id in order to avoid overwriting old
## files in case new ones with identical names are created; always true for
## untitled documents
## 0: label untitled documents only
## 1: label all documents with a preceeding "job_#-"
## 2: label all documents with a tailing "-job_#"
### Default: 0
#Label 0
### Key: TitlePref (config, ppd, lpoptions)
## where to look first for a title when creating the output filename
## (title in PS file or title on commandline):
## 0: prefer title from %Title statement in the PS file
## 1: prefer title passed via commandline
### Default: 0
#TitlePref 0
###########################################################################
# #
# User Settings #
# #
###########################################################################
### Key: AnonUser (config)
## uid for anonymous PDF creation (this might be a security issue)
## this setting has no influence on AnonDirName (see there)
## set this to an empty value to disable anonymous
### Default: nobody
#AnonUser nobody
### Key: LowerCase (config)
## This options allows to check user names given to CUPS-PDF additionally
## against their lower case variants. This is necessary since in some
## Windows environments only upper case user names are passed. Usually UNIX
## user names are all lower case and it is save to use this option
## but be aware that it can lead to mis-identifications in case
## you have user names that differ only in upper/lower case.
## check only against user name as passed to CUPS : 0
## check additionally against lower case user name : 1
### Default: 1
#LowerCase 1
### Key: UserPrefix (config)
## some installations require a domain prefix added to the user name
## leave empty for no prefix
### Default: <empty>
#UserPrefix
### Key: DirPrefix (config)
## if a prefix was defined above this switch toggels whether to include
## the prefix in the output directory's name (if not $HOME) or not
## 0: do not include, 1: include
### Default: 0
#DirPrefix 0
### Key: RemovePrefix (config)
## some installation pass usernames with a prefix (usually a domain name)
## if you do not want this prefix to be used by the ${USER} variable for
## output directories put the part which is to be cut here
### Default: <empty>
#RemovePrefix
###########################################################################
# #
# Security Settings #
# #
###########################################################################
### Key: AnonUMask (config)
## umask for anonymous output
## these are the _inverse_ permissions to be granted
### Default: 0000
#AnonUMask 0000
### Key: UserUMask (config, lptoptions)
## umask for user output of known users
## changing this can introduce security leaks if confidential
## information is processed!
### Default: 0077
#UserUMask 0077
### Key: Grp (config)
## group cups-pdf is supposed to run as - this will also be the gid for all
## created directories and log files
### Default: cups
Grp cups
### Key: AllowUnsafeOptions (config)
## DON'T CHANGE THIS SETTING UNLESS YOU ABSOLUTELY KNOW WHAT YOU ARE DOING
## set to 1 in order to allow users to override any option - including
## those that pose SEVERE SECURITY RISKS, set to 0 for full security
### Default: 0
#AllowUnsafeOptions 0
###########################################################################
# #
# Log Settings #
# #
###########################################################################
### Key: Log (config)
## CUPS-PDF log directory
## set this to an empty value to disable all logging
### Default: /var/log/cups
#Log /var/log/cups
### Key: LogType (config, ppd)
## log-mode
## 1: errors
## 2: status (i.e. activity)
## 4: debug - this will generate a lot of log-output!
## add up values to combine options, i.e. 7 is full logging
## if logging is disabled these setting have no effect
### Default: 3
#LogType 3
###########################################################################
# #
# PDF Conversion Settings #
# #
###########################################################################
### Key: GhostScript (config)
## location of GhostScript binary (gs)
## MacOSX: for using pstopdf (recommended) set this to /usr/bin/pstopdf
## or its proper location on your system
### Default: /usr/bin/gs
#GhostScript /usr/bin/gs
### Key: GSTmp (config)
## location of temporary files during GhostScript operation
## this must be user-writable like /var/tmp or /tmp !
### Default: /var/tmp
#GSTmp /var/tmp
### Key: GSCall (config)
## command line for calling GhostScript (!!! DO NOT USE NEWLINES !!!)
## MacOSX: for using pstopdf set this to %s %s -o %s %s
### Default: %s -q -dCompatibilityLevel=%s -dNOPAUSE -dBATCH -dSAFER -sDEVICE=pdfwrite -sOutputFile="%s" -dAutoRotatePages=/PageByPage -dAutoFilterColorImages=false -dColorImageFilter=/FlateEncode -dPDFSETTINGS=/prepress -c -f %s
#GSCall %s -q -dCompatibilityLevel=%s -dNOPAUSE -dBATCH -dSAFER -sDEVICE=pdfwrite -sOutputFile="%s" -dAutoRotatePages=/PageByPage -dAutoFilterColorImages=false -dColorImageFilter=/FlateEncode -dPDFSETTINGS=/prepress -c -f %s
### Key: PDFVer (config, ppd, lptopions)
## PDF version to be created - can be "1.5", "1.4", "1.3" or "1.2"
## MacOSX: for using pstopdf set this to an empty value
### Default: 1.4
#PDFVer 1.4
### Key: PostProcessing (config, lptoptions)
## postprocessing script that will be called after the creation of the PDF
## as arguments the filename of the PDF, the username as determined by
## CUPS-PDF and the one as given to CUPS-PDF will be passed
## the script will be called with user privileges
## set this to an empty value to use no postprocessing
### Default: <empty>
#PostProcessing
###########################################################################
# #
# Experimental Settings #
# These settings activate experimental options. If you decide to use #
# them I would appreciate any feedback - including an 'ok' if they #
# work as expected - so I can eventually put them into the non- #
# experimental sections. #
# #
###########################################################################
### Key: DecodeHexStrings (config)
## this option will try to decode hex strings in the title to allow
## internationalized titles
## (have a look at pstitleconv on www.cups-pdf.de for a suitable filter
## for data from Windows clients)
## 0: disable, 1: enable
### Default: 0
#DecodeHexStrings 0
### Key: FixNewlines (config)
## this option will try to fix various unusal line delimiters (e.g.
## form feeds)
## especially useful when using non-Linux-generated files
## 0: disable, 1: enable
### Default: 0
#FixNewlines 0
